Google refunds some Stadia Pro subscriptions amid backlash

Alphabet Inc. GOOG GOOGL Google is reportedly refunding customers for Stadia Pro purchases, though the subscription is not eligible for a refund.

What happened to a thread on Reddit showing how Google refunded some users their monthly Stadia Pro subscription fees.

The thread shows Google returning 8.99 - the monthly cost for Stadia Pro when it was active.

The refund was an unexpected Thanksgiving gift for users, because Google said it won't refund Stadia pro subscriptions.

The U.K. acccorded to a report in 9 to 5 Google, a group of refund recipients showed that they were primarily from the U.K.

The report said that Google's refund of the money could be an error on the part of the company. It added that those who get the money won't be asked to return it.

In September, Google announced that it would shut down Stadia as the gaming service didn't attract enough traction.

The tech giant will use the technology powering Stadia to scale YouTube, Google Play and the company's Augmented Reality efforts while also making it available for industry partners.
